Tesla’s yoke steering wheel saga continues, and not in a good way.

After backtracking on the idea that a fighter jet-inspired steering wheel should be the only available

option for the updated Model S and Model X, Tesla offered customers the chance to swap their steering wheels, for a price.

That offer was so popular that it sold out in eight days. However, it also came back to bite

 Tesla eight months later because the service technicians may have installed the wrong airbag in the steering wheel after swapping it for a different model.

suspected cars will have to be physically inspected and get a replacement driver airbag if the wrong one is installed.
